Output 03af265f136b149d8d4f9a168fd8361b62d0912d015d5f29a38b1876572624c7:1

value
999024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a03522c0f876365e3a50dc4405091f574f3d493 OP_EQUAL
address
35XAHM4ZGbWbTQzkYRa1R9sJTbuvMg21Ta
transaction
03af265f136b149d8d4f9a168fd8361b62d0912d015d5f29a38b1876572624c7
confirmations
285667
spent
true